T5 speedometer gear question

I think I already know the answer but I am assuming you are not supposed to be able to spin the speedometer drive gear freely if the speedometer gear is ok or even there. Reason is the sppedometer has been replaced as well as the cable and the driven gear and still no movement from the speedometer.

Re: T5 speedometer gear question

Correct. It may be worn down, installed incorrectly (with regard to location) or have moved due to lack of proper locating clip.
